    Lawn care for Temecula, California

    Typical lawn size in Temecula 1,552 sq. ft.
    Dominant grass types in Temecula Warm and cool season grasses like tall fescue, Kentucky bluegrass, perennial ryegrass, bermudagrass, and zoysiagrass
    Typical soil pH for Temecula lawns 7.7, slightly alkaline
    Typical organic matter in Temecula lawns 4.72%
    Temecula lawn soil composition 54% sand, 33% silt, 13% clay
    Key soil nutrients in Temecula lawns Phosphorus: 102 ppm, Potassium: 155 ppm, Calcium: 2,242 ppm, Iron: 156 ppm

    Temecula lawn care starts with understanding your soil. The sandy loam soil common in this California city drains well but may need extra attention to retain nutrients and moisture. With a pH of 7.7, Temecula lawns tend toward alkaline, which affects how grass takes up nutrients from the soil.

    A custom lawn plan can help you make the most of your yard, whether you have warm-season bermudagrass or cool-season tall fescue. Most Temecula yards are around 1,500 square feet, making them manageable for DIY lawn care.

    Key steps for lawn care in Temecula:

    • Check soil health with a soil test kit to plan fertilizer timing
    • Add organic matter to improve sandy soil structure
    • Water deeply but less often to encourage deep root growth
    • Adjust mowing height seasonally - higher in summer for better drought resistance

      Temecula, California FAQs

      For Temecula lawns:

      1. Mow tall (3-3.5 inches) to promote deeper roots and drought resistance
      2. Water deeply but infrequently, ideally early morning 2-3 times per week
      3. Fertilize in spring and fall when temperatures are moderate
      4. Overseed warm-season grasses in spring, cool-season in fall
      5. Control weeds through proper mowing height and spot treatment
      6. Dethatch and aerate annually in spring or fall to reduce soil compaction

      Water your Temecula lawn 2-3 times per week in early morning, applying about 1 inch of water each week. During summer heat (June-September), increase to 3-4 times per week. Reduce watering to once per week during cooler months (November-February).

      The 1/3 rule states you should never cut off more than one-third of the grass blade height in a single mowing. This preserves grass health by maintaining enough leaf surface for photosynthesis and prevents shocking the plant. Mow regularly to maintain proper height.

      Common lawn pests in Temecula include:

      • Grubs (beetle larvae that feed on grass roots)
      • Chinch bugs (small insects that suck grass sap)
      • Sod webworms (caterpillars that eat grass blades)
      • Fire ants (build mounds and damage roots)
      • Armyworms (caterpillars that feed on grass)

      Focus on maintaining healthy grass through proper watering and fertilization to naturally deter pests.

      Temecula's Mediterranean climate creates specific lawn care challenges. Hot, dry summers (80-95°F) require increased watering and heat-tolerant grass varieties. Mild winters (40-65°F) allow year-round growth but reduced watering needs. The climate supports both warm and cool-season grasses when properly maintained with appropriate fertilization and irrigation.

      How to grow grass in Temecula, California

      Most common grass types in Temecula Warm and cool season grasses
      Best way to grow grass in Temecula Seeding for cool-season grasses, seeding or sodding for warm-season grasses
      Recommended grass species for Temecula lawns Tall fescue, Kentucky bluegrass, perennial ryegrass, bermudagrass, zoysiagrass
      When to start growing grass in Temecula Cool-season: Spring from March 25 to April 25 or Fall from October 1 to October 31, Warm-season: Late Spring to Early Summer from April 29 to June 10

      Lawn care in Temecula offers flexibility for both warm and cool-season grasses, making it possible to maintain a green lawn year-round in California. The city's climate supports popular grass types like tall fescue and bermudagrass, which can be established through seeding or sodding.

      The best time to plant depends on your grass type:

      • Cool-season grasses: Plant in spring (March 25-April 25) or fall (October 1-31)
      • Warm-season grasses: Plant during late spring through early summer (April 29-June 10)
